If you count the height off the sea floor the tallest volcano would be Mauna Loa with a rough height of 58,000 feet from base to summit. THis number is taken from the 11,000 feet above sealevel, plus the additional 28,000 feet to the sea floor, and another 19,000 feet that has been compressed into the sea floor due to the large weight of the mountain.

A Rift zone Underwater volcano?

Yes, also known as seafloor spreading! A rift zone volcano is called a mid-ocean ridge. The seafloor splits & spreads apart at a mid-ocean ridge, with lava seeping out of this fissure. The lava forms new seafloor. The older seafloor moves away from the ridge. Therefore, our ocean floor is actually spreading, at a rate of about two inches per year in the Atlantic ocean, and about 13 in the Pacific.
